Is it possible to use a UMTS (USB) modem with a PDA?
I'm looking into getting mobile internet to substitute my landline, ISP and possibly even mobile phone provider!
Got the HTC Touch (windows mobile) which is not capable of receiving 3G signal. Will I be able to get online by using a USB cable to connect this with the Touch? |
Yes and No.
First of all; the Touch doesn't have the correct USB mode, so you can't connect USB devices to it. Secondly; Windows Mobile doesn't have the ability to connect over anything other than Cellular or WiFi. What you COULD do is get a 3G router and plug the 3G modem into that, then connect the touch over WiFi to the 3G router. |

Third the cradlepoint. It gives you the ability to set up a hotspot anywhere you have a cellular signal. That's KILLER.
The router accepts USB evdo modems (e.g. the 595U from Sprint or Verizon) or hard wire internet and turns it into a wireless signal. However, if you just want to pull the phone out for a short web session than using a wireless modem to a router is a bit kludgy and you'd be happier with a data plan for the phone regardless of the download speeds.
